K-P CM Gandapur vows to overcome all obstacles to reach Rawalpindi for PTI protest

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Chief Minister, Ali Amin Gandapur, declared that they will overcome every obstacle to reach Rawalpindi.

In a defiant message to the Punjab government, he stated, “Do whatever you can; we are not afraid,” signaling their readiness to face any challenge.

According to Express News, Gandapur’s convoy has reached Mardan, where he addressed the media, claiming, “Something big is about to happen.” He also highlighted the imposition of Section 804 in Pakistan, affirming, “We will overcome every obstacle to get to Rawalpindi; let’s see what happens next.”

He further urged the Punjab government to perform its duties, reiterating their resolve, “Whatever the Punjab government can do, let it do; we are not afraid.”

Meanwhile, the Rawalpindi administration has completely shut down the city, blocking PTI’s planned protest at Liaquat Bagh by placing containers. This blockade has caused significant inconvenience to residents as no vehicles are being allowed into the city.

Thousands of police personnel have been deployed across various locations to ensure the enforcement of Section 144, which bans public gatherings, protests, or the display of weapons. In response, the district administration has erected barriers, and law enforcement agencies maintain a strong presence throughout the city.

Liaquat Bagh has been fully sealed, and as part of the preventive measures, the metro bus service has also been partially suspended.
